Venue Tips
Roadrunner Food Bank's volunteer warehouse is at 5840 Office Blvd NE, just north of I-40 between Eubank and Juan Tabo (NE Heights). Most shifts are warehouse-based β sorting donated food, packing senior boxes, or handling produce β closed-toe shoes required, and dress for a warehouse environment (no shorts/skirts, layers help year-round). Sign-in is at the front office; large free parking lot. Shifts typically run 9 AMβnoon or 1β4 PM. Bring water; the warehouse can run warm in summer and cool in winter.
